Bereavement (2010) is a gritty American crime-horror film that serves as a prequel to the 2004 slasher Malevolence . Directed by Stevan Mena, the film explores the dark origin story of Martin Bristol, a young boy with a rare condition that makes him unable to feel physical pain.
